This paper describes statistical analysis of web data traffic to identify the probability distribution best fitting the connection arrivals and to evaluate whether data traffic traces follow heavy-tail distributions an indication of fractal behaviour, which is in contrast to conventional data traffic. Modelling of the fractal nature of web data traffic is used to specify classes of fractal computing methods which are capable of accurately describing the burstiness behaviour of the measured data, thereby establishing web data traffic patterns. |
